- Arcusaflex AC-T 5 Rubber CouplingThe REICH Arcusaflex AC-T 5 rubber coupling is a highly flexible flywheel coupling designed for diesel engines, generators, air compressors, drilling rigs, and industrial power transmission systems. It is engineered to provide reliable torque transmission, reduce torsional vibration, absorb shock loads, and protect connected drivetrain components such as gearboxes, shafts, bearings, and compressor drives.For maintenance teams, procurement specialists, and industrial buyers, the Arcusaflex ACT 5 SN / AC-T 5 NN / AC-T 5 UN / AC-T 5 WN offers a dependable replacement option with strong fitment reliability, stable performance, and reduced long-term maintenance costs.Key FeaturesHighly flexible rubber flywheel couplingEffective torsional vibration dampingHelps reduce shock loads and drivetrain stressSupports smoother torque transmissionSuitable for diesel engines, generators, and compressor systemsAvailable in multiple elastomer hardness optionsDesigned for demanding industrial and heavy-duty applicationsOEM-style replacement qualityHelps reduce wear on connected mechanical componentsTechnical Specifications by VariantVariantRubber HardnessNormal TorqueMax TorqueWNShore 551800 N.m4500 N.mNNShore 652000 N.m5400 N.mSNShore 752500 N.m7500 N.mUNShore 852900 N.m7500 N.mThese variants allow industrial users to choose the correct coupling based on application torque, operating load, and vibration requirements.ApplicationsThe Arcusaflex AC-T 5 coupling is used in a broad range of diesel engine, compressor, and industrial equipment applications:Brand / EquipmentCompatible Models / UseCaterpillar9.3B, CAT C7.1 China NR4MTU8V 2000 M72, 10V 2000 M72CumminsX12, ISL, QSK19, KTA 19MAND4276, E3262, D2676Weichai6M21ZF Gearbox2000, 2150, 2075, 2200Atlas CopcoAir Compressor, Drilling RigsSullairAir Compressor, Part No. 250037-556This coupling is well suited for engine-to-gearbox connections, compressor drives, generator systems, and heavy industrial rotating equipment.Replacement Part Numbers & Search ReferencesThis product may also be found under the following names and search terms:Arcusaflex AC-T 5 SNACT5SNREICH AC-T 5Rubber Coupling AC-T 5 NNArcusaflex ACT 5 SNReich Kupplungen AC-T 5AC-T 5 flywheel couplingArcusaflex AC-T 5 NN / UN / WNThese search references help buyers and technical teams identify the correct replacement part during sourcing and maintenance planning.Why Industrial Buyers Choose Arcusaflex AC-T 5The Arcusaflex AC-T 5 is chosen for applications where vibration control, torque stability, and drivetrain protection are essential.
